Understanding the Core Mechanics and Challenges

At its foundation, the gameplay centers around timing and prediction. Players must carefully observe the flow of traffic – the speed, spacing, and patterns of vehicles – and identify safe opportunities to advance the chicken across the road. Factors like vehicle speed, the density of traffic, and even the chicken's movement speed can all influence the difficulty. Successfully navigating the road requires a blend of observation, anticipation, and quick reflexes. It's not simply about reacting to immediate threats; it's about anticipating where those threats will be in the next moment. A key element of the enjoyable experience is the feeling of accomplishment that comes with making a daring maneuver, slipping through a narrow gap in traffic, or stringing together a series of successful crossings.

The Role of Increasing Difficulty

Most iterations of this style of game incorporate a dynamically increasing difficulty curve. As the player progresses, the speed of the vehicles often increases, the intervals between them shorten, and the overall traffic density rises. This escalation in challenge prevents the gameplay from becoming monotonous and, importantly, encourages repeat plays as players seek to overcome the rising difficulty. The introduction of new obstacles or vehicle types further adds to the complexity and can create unexpected challenges. For example, certain versions might introduce trucks that take longer to pass, or motorcycles that weave erratically. These variations necessitate constant adaptation and a refined strategy. The game constantly pushes the player to improve their skills and reaction time.

Strategies for Mastering the Chicken Crossing

While the chicken road game relies heavily on reflexes, employing strategic thinking can significantly improve your performance. One effective technique is to scan the entire road before making a move, rather than focusing solely on the immediate lane. Identifying gaps further ahead allows for more calculated and safer crossings. Another useful strategy is to learn the patterns of the traffic; many games feature predictable vehicle movements, and recognizing these patterns can give you a crucial edge. Additionally, mastering the timing of taps or clicks – the control mechanism for moving the chicken – is paramount. Too early or too late, and the chicken will meet an untimely end.

Optimizing Your Touch Control

The responsiveness of the touch controls is critical in succeeding. Experimenting with different grip positions and finger techniques can yield surprising results. Some players find that using the pad of their thumb offers greater precision, while others prefer the edge of their finger for quicker taps. Adjusting the in-game sensitivity settings, if available, can further refine the control scheme to match your individual preferences. Practice makes perfect, and dedicated practice sessions focused on optimizing your touch control will undoubtedly translate to higher scores and more successful crossings. Developing a consistent and comfortable control scheme is key to minimizing errors and maximizing your reaction time.

The Psychology of Addiction in Simple Games

The enduring popularity of the chicken road game, and similar hyper-casual titles, begs the question: what makes these seemingly simple games so addictive? Much of the answer lies in the principles of behavioral psychology. The game capitalizes on the variable ratio reinforcement schedule, a technique commonly used in slot machines. Players are rewarded – with continued survival and a higher score – on an unpredictable basis, which keeps them engaged and motivated to keep playing. The near misses – narrowly avoiding a collision – also trigger a dopamine release in the brain, creating a sense of excitement and encouraging further play. The game also provides a sense of accomplishment. Each successful crossing, each new high score, provides a small but satisfying sense of achievement.

The Role of Quick Rewards and Instant Gratification

The instant gratification provided by even a small success—surviving one more crossing—is a powerful driver of engagement. Unlike more complex games that require significant time and effort to see tangible progress, the chicken road game provides immediate feedback and rewards. This constant stream of positive reinforcement keeps players hooked, even when they’re facing repeated failures. The accessibility of the game – the fact that it can be played in short bursts – also contributes to its addictive nature. It fits seamlessly into the fragmented attention spans of modern life, providing a convenient and readily available source of entertainment. The simplicity of the gameplay removes barriers to entry, making it appealing to a broad audience.

Exploring Variations and Game Modes

The basic premise of the chicken road game has been expanded upon in numerous variations, introducing new mechanics and game modes to keep the experience fresh and engaging. Some versions incorporate power-ups – temporary boosts that grant the chicken special abilities, such as increased speed or invincibility. Others introduce different environments, ranging from bustling city streets to rural highways, each with its unique visual style and traffic patterns. Still others implement collectable items, encouraging players to take risks and explore different parts of the road. These additions add layers of complexity and replayability, appealing to players seeking a more dynamic and rewarding experience.

The introduction of multiplayer modes represents another significant evolution of the genre. Competing against other players in real time adds a competitive element that can significantly enhance engagement. Leaderboards and social sharing features further incentivize players to strive for higher scores and bragging rights. The ability to customize the chicken’s appearance – with different skins or accessories – offers a sense of personalization and allows players to express their individuality. By constantly innovating and introducing new features, developers are ensuring that the chicken road game remains a relevant and popular form of entertainment.
